The Covid-19 Pandemic has required us all to be both resilient and empathetic. Paige Mathison has been in the middle of it all. As a psychiatric nurse, she not only tended to her clients’ mental health needs, but also those of her co-workers.
Having worked as a clinical counselor, guiding college and university students through anxiety during the pandemic, Paige brings us a perspective of building identity in the post-secondary experience. In this episode, she explains how she uses strengths-based, positive psychology with students as a guiding light towards healing.
Paige Mathison holds a Master of Arts in Counseling Psychology.
